KFS Board Fired as Justice for Family Involved in Likoni Tragedy Starts

The last one month has been tragic for the family of John Wambua after his wife, Mariam Kighenda, and four-year-old daughter, Amanda Mutheu, sank into the Indian Ocean in the view of glaring mobile videographers.
The Country literally came to a standstill as videos of the car which onboard had the young Amanda and her mother did rounds on social media, the head of the family, John Wambua was to receive the news first from twitter before the Kenya Ferry called in.
Questions have been asked on whether there was nothing that could be done to save Mariam Kighenda and her toddler daughter, Amanda, with most witnesses saying the car floated for over 15 minutes which should have been sufficient to rescue them.
Witnesses have also alluded to the fact that the Kenya Navy was in sight when the Likoni tragedy car was sinking, practicing for the upcoming Mashujaa day, but they did not put in an effort to rescue Mariam and Amanda.
A tragedy had occurred; a mother and her daughter lay on the floor of the Indian Ocean for 13 days with the World turning its focus to the Kenyan government which has never looked more helpless.
President Uhuru Kenyatta kept his silence in the eyes of the public, may be too embarrassed by his own government’s inability to ensure safety to its citizens, how a car would slide off a ferry left many confused.
President Uhuru has decided to send the whole Kenya Ferry Services board packing in a special gazette notice dated 16th of October 2019, revoking the appointment of Dan Mwazo as Chairman of the Kenya Ferry Services board and Daula Omar, Naima Amir, Philip Ndolo, Rosina Nasigha Mruttu as members.
“IN EXERCISE of the powers conferred by section 7 (3) of the State Corporations Act, I, Uhuru Kenyatta, President and Commander-in-Chief of the Defence Forces of the Republic of Kenya, revokes the appointments of Dan Mwazo, Daula Omar, Naima Amir, Philip Ndolo, Rosina Nasigha Mruttu, as Non-Executive Chairperson and members of the Kenya Ferry Services Limited, with effect from the 16th October, 2019,” the notice reads.
John Wambua accused the Kenya Ferry Services over the death of his wife and daughter saying his wife, Mariam Kighenda, was an experienced driver and he believes she would never have made such a mistake to reverse out of the ferry midstream.
A post-mortem conducted at Jocham Hospital mortuary in Mombasa on the bodies of Mariam Kighenda and Amanda revealed that the two died out of suffocation.
There can never be justice to the family of John Wambua but it sure is important that effective people are at the helm to avoid such tragedies in the future.
